
Raised in Maryland and Pennsylvania, Markley was trained as an architect at the University of Pennsylvania. He had offices in Harrisburg, PA, and Richmond, VA, before coming to North Carolina - first to Chapel Hill and then Durham. His commissions included a number of residential and institutional structures throughout the city and across the state from the late 1920s until his death in 1959.
